Valuable Tips About Credit Repair That Will Benefit You


There are a lot of people that want to repair their credit but they don’t know what steps they need to take towards their credit repair. If you want to repair your credit you’re going to have to learn as many tips as you can to do that, tips like the ones in this article that are geared towards helping you repair your credit.

When it comes to credit repair one of the first things you should do is analyze your credit report and dispute or challenge anything that is questionable. After you have done this you may find disputable negatives were lowering your credit score rather significantly and may see your score go up.

When closing credit accounts close them out gradually not all at once, and close only the newest ones so that you retain the credit history afforded by the older ones. Rapid closings are indicitive of financial troubles and as such are looked at very negatively by agencies that offer credit.

One thing to do if you are looking to repair your credit is to open a savings account at your bank. Not only will you save money and earn a little interest but it also shows creditors that you are diligently working on establishing a fund that you can fall back on in times of need.

If you have bad credit and are looking to repair it then check with the companies you are paying on time every time and see if they are reporting it to credit agencies. Some companies, like has stations, do not report and you can ask them to to help support that you have stable credit.

When trying to repair your credit keep a keen eye aware of possible credit repair scams. For example any company that wants money upfront for services is likely a scam. This is because the credit repair organizations act says credit repair companies cannot require you to past until they have completed their services.

Order a free credit report and comb it for any errors there may be. Making sure your credit reports are accurate is the easiest way to repair your credit since you put in relatively little time and energy for significant score improvements. You can order your credit report through companies like Equifax for free.

To help you repair your credit, a critical measure you must take is beginning to pay your bills on time. One of the biggest determinants of a person’s credit store is how many payments he or she has missed. Stop this bad habit as soon as you can to help you repair your credit.

If you know that you are going to be late on a payment or that the balances have gotten away from you, contact the business and see if you can set up an arrangement. It is much easier to keep a company from reporting something to your credit report than it is to have it fixed later.

A great way to settle debt on your credit report is to call up your creditors and see if they are willing to settle the account for less money. Although this is not as favorable as paying the debt in full, it will still show up on your credit report as account settled.

Fix Your Credit History By Using These Ideas


When you have a bad credit record, you tend to feel bad about your financial situation. What you should remember is that, regardless of you previous actions, you have a way out of your predicament. In fact, there are many steps you can take to get on the road to improved credit. Here are just a few of them:

After you have finished making payments with a debt consolidation company, you should follow up with the credit reporting agencies to make sure everything is updated on their end. Make sure your debts have been marked as paid and there aren’t any remaining negative marks against your credit. If there are, you should contact the debt consolidation company.

Stay organized. Filing your credit card and other loan bills all together in a location that is easily accessible will go a long way in keeping you organized and able to stay on top of your bills. It’s easy to forget to pay a bill that you have carelessly tossed in a growing pile of unwanted mail. Segregating your bills will help to prevent this.

You should check your credit report at least once a year. You can do this for free by contacting one of the 3 major credit reporting agencies. You can look up their website, call them or send them a letter to request your free credit report. Each company will give you one report a year.

Make sure that you’re going over your monthly credit card statements for accuracy. This will allow you to potentially catch errors that might otherwise be documented by the credit reporting agencies, making them more difficult to resolve. If you find an error on a monthly statement, immediately call the credit card company to have it corrected.
